Description Michail Vourlakos 2018-08-28 11:03:44 UTC
The issues appears when we change from a theme that contains panel shadows to one that doesnt. When the current plasma theme supports shadows and the one to change to it doesnt then the plasma panel after the plasma theme change still draws the shadows from the old theme

Steps to reproduce:

1. Install one theme that doesnt have panel shadows e.g. Unity Ambiance (does not support panel shadows)
2. Choose Unity Ambiance and re-login to plasma you will see your panels without any shadows
3. Change your plasma theme to Air
4. All panel shadows are drawn correctly
5. Change your plasma theme back to Unity Ambiance, you will notice that shadows from Air are still drawn even though they shouldnt
Comment 1 Kai Uwe Broulik 2018-08-28 11:16:03 UTC
It laso doesn't work vice-versa, switching from Unity Ambiance to a theme with panel shadows doesn't show them unless you restart plasmashell
